Overwatch World Cup Archives | Invision Game Community
France and UK set for Overwatch World Cup Top 8 at BlizzCon

France and the United Kingdom finished first and second at the Overwatch World Cup Paris Group Stage this past weekend, each securing a place in the Top 8 at BlizzCon this November. All six teams—France, the United Kingdom, the Netherlands,…

Meet your Overwatch World Cup Competition Committees

After two phases of voting across two months, the competition committees for the Overwatch World Cup have been finalized. Each includes a general manager, coach, and a community lead, who will collectively make decisions regarding each national team’s roster, management,…

Announcing the 2018 Overwatch World Cup

Two years ago, we debuted the Overwatch World Cup, and 2017 saw it evolve and expand further. Now it’s time to announce the return of this global celebration of high-level play: the 2018 Overwatch World Cup, which begins today and…